The Reality Of Savings On Electricity Bills With Solar Panels

Savings is a sealed deal with solar panels but everyone wants to know the amount that would stay in their pockets after incorporating solar power into their routines. For estimating the savings, you need to have a record of your current electricity spending every year.

Let’s understand this with an example – On average, an American household utilizes 10,649 kilowatt-hours (kWh) of electricity on an annual basis. Considering the national average electricity rate as of October 2020 ($0.1360 per kWh) and multiplying this value with the usage, we find that a U.S. family is paying almost $1,450 every year for attaining constant access to electricity.

Since the rates of electricity are never constant and witness unpredictable changes (mostly on the upward side), we need to keep those trends in mind and calculate accordingly. While making a comparison between the prices of home solar power and utility electricity, you should take into account the escalating rates of electricity every year. According to the statistics, the electricity rates of the country have risen at a rate of 2.2% (approximately) per year.

The inflation in the utility rates is an inducement to go solar as with a rooftop PV (photovoltaic) system that gives you the power to generate your own energy, you will be dealing with a stable rate of energy. Hence, offering you freedom from the fluctuating utility costs.

As solar offers an up-front investment, you will only be paying for the installation. For a case when the solar panels are unable to make up for your entire electricity utilization, you may have to handle the electricity costs for that period. To ensure that the solar panel system balances your electricity requirements, you must have an accurate idea of the sizing of the PV system that is being installed. It becomes essential to have a proper calculation of the number of solar panels that will offset the electricity needs completely.

Do Electricity Bills And Solar Panels Go Hand-in-Hand?

One fallacy that many believe is that the electric bill becomes a total thing of the past after the installation of the solar panels. Here’s the truth – you will still have to collect the electricity bill sent by your utility despite the installed PV system that is capable of delivering to your electric demands. The bill will always be a part of your home if your property stays grid-connected. However, you can’t conclude that you will still be paying and there is a reason to back this statement:

With a billing mechanism known as net metering that has been incorporated in various states, the whole process of electricity bills and solar power is made less complicated. This allows the energy that is not instantly utilized but is produced by your solar panels to be added to the grid. In return, you earn credits on your electricity bill.

This whole policy is favorable to the people in the way that they can consume the grid’s energy at night when the sun is not present to shine on the solar panels without paying additional dollars. This is applicable if you are extracting the same or less amount of energy that you offered the grid initially. Your monthly electricity bill will reflect the net metering credits that you consumed in that particular month and you will not have to pay for that amount of power.

You will only see the charges for the additional electricity that you drew from the grid that wasn’t counterbalanced by the net metering credits and had not been produced and utilized instantly at your house.

So, we can conclude that the electric bill won’t vanish from your life with the installation of solar panels. The bill may just arrive without asking for any payment and will only inform you about your utilization. It will state the balancing of your usage with the net metering credits for that specific month. If your supply to the grid was greater than the electricity that you drew from it, then the utility has the power to transfer those extra bill credits to the next month. So, you are at an advantage!

Also, once you have solar panels installed, you will witness a decrease in the monthly electric bill and you won’t have to alter your budget every time the electricity rates move upwards. You may even receive a monthly electricity bill with a null amount at times when solar panels generate enough power according to your requirements in the house.

Impact Of Solar Panels On Carbon Footprint

While saving on the utility bill is one of the major reasons for bringing solar panels to your home but there’s another huge advantage that has nothing to do with the financial benefits. When you go solar, you are contributing hugely to helping our environment breathe by decreasing the emissions of greenhouse gases to a significant extent.
So, while you save money on your electricity bills, you are saving the environment too as there would be lesser carbon dioxide emissions into the atmosphere.

Going solar will lead to a positive impact on the Earth as the amount of carbon dioxide making its way into the atmosphere will be reduced. Let’s understand it with a valid and practical comparison: An automobile is responsible for 4.7 metric tons of carbon dioxide being added to the atmosphere every year. According to the calculations by the Environmental Protection Agency, a 6 kW solar panel system reduces 6.3 metric tons of carbon emissions. So, this implies that such solar panel offsets the carbon dioxide emissions by one typical vehicle running on fossil fuels. Turns out, a solar panel is equivalent to keeping a car away from running on the roads.

Inference: Big Savings By Going Solar

After various calculations, research and studies, it can be concluded that solar panels offer huge savings, in terms of both, finances and the environment. Your utility bills will reduce and the carbon emissions will experience a decline too. According to thorough calculations, with a 6 kilowatts solar panel system being installed and considering the inflation in the utility rates to be 2.2%, 20-year electricity savings are quite impressive. The 20-year savings through solar start from $10k and can reach $30k when the demand for electricity is taken as 10,649 kilowatt-hours per year as the national average.

The actual value saved will depend on the true cost of electricity in your area as it varies from region to region. However, practically, it’s observed that in the states that have middle-level or upper-level utility rates, solar will become a fitting investment without any risks offering great returns.
The amount of emissions depends on the size of the solar panel system. The larger solar panel will mean that the carbon dioxide reductions in the environment will increase. So, solar panels are definitely a green move and a perfectly eco-friendly investment.
